Transponder Keys

Transponder keys are likely to be used in cars manufactured in the past 20 years. This is because these keys are utilized by a variety of automakers to reduce the risk of theft. These keys are a lot more difficult to duplicate, and the vehicle will only begin to start when it recognizes its unique serial number.

The keys also come with an embedded microchip that has been programmed to match your car's code. This assures that only you will be authorized to use your vehicle. The keys are made of rubber or plastic head and the chip is typically inside it. Some people refer to these as "chip keys" or "transponder keys". If you own a transponder key, you will need to bring it to a locksmith in order to get it copied or replaced.

Key Fobs

When people use the term "key fob" today, they're talking about an electronic device used to control access to a vehicle. Key fobs are designed to be small and convenient. They're an excellent alternative to traditional keys because they allow you to unlock and start cars remotely. Some come with additional features, such as panic buttons and GPS tracking capabilities.

Key fobs are small, battery-operated devices that look similar to regular car keys but have added features. They can lock and unlock doors remotely, start the car engine and open a trunk or use solar power to power a roof. They can also trigger chirping sounds or send signals to a smartphone application, which can help drivers find their car in crowded parking lots.

The majority of cars use keyfobs in place of traditional keys. They are safer, because they require an authentication signal to function. They are also able to be canceled by the owner, making them more difficult for thieves to steal.

Key Fob Switchblade Key

Unlike basic key fobs, that lock and unlock the car door and do not include any electronic components key fobs with switchblade keys contain a metal key shank that folds into the fob and then pops out when you press the button. They've been around since the 1990s and were specifically designed to stop theft. The key head is equipped with an embedded chip that emits an radio signal when it is within the range of an ignition receiver. If the signal isn't right the car won't start. This type of key for cars must be programmed, which can cost between $50 and $100.

Fobs that have a key made of metal and a switchblade are more difficult to steal and more expensive to replace. These fobs are laser-cut and be priced between $200 and $300.
